Surfaces local services reachable from the mesh, paired with their
current `inet fips` baseline filter classification. Lands to the
right of the existing TUN section in the Traffic block.
A new daemon control query `show_listening_sockets` returns IPv6
listeners bound to either `::` (wildcard) or the node's fd00::/8
address, each classified as Accept / Drop / Unknown / NoFirewall
against the running inbound chain. fipstop renders the result as a
table beside the Traffic counters: Accept rows in default White,
Drop / Unknown in DarkGray, a yellow banner above the table when
`fips-firewall.service` is inactive, and a trailing `*` on
wildcard binds to remind the operator the bind is not
fips0-specific.
Daemon side:
- `src/control/listening.rs` walks `/proc/net/tcp6` and
`/proc/net/udp6` via the procfs crate (LISTEN state for TCP,
wildcard remote for UDP), filters to fips0-reachable binds, and
resolves inodes to PID / comm via `/proc/<pid>/fd`.
- `src/control/firewall_state.rs` shells out to
`nft -j list table inet fips` and walks the inbound chain.
Recognises canonical accepts (`tcp/udp dport N accept`,
`dport { ... } accept`, `dport A-B accept`), the iifname-scoping
line, conntrack and icmpv6 lines (skipped). Any rule with
unrecognised matchers (saddr filters, jumps, daddr filters) or
non-terminal verdicts forces Unknown classification for the
ports it references. Eleven unit tests cover the classification
logic; the listening enumerator carries a /proc-parsing test of
its own.
- `show_listening_sockets` emits
`{fips0_addr, firewall_active, sockets[]}` with per-row
`{proto, local_addr, port, pid, process, filter, wildcard_bind}`.
fipstop side:
- `src/bin/fipstop/ui/dashboard.rs` splits the Traffic block into
a 50/50 horizontal layout; the existing TUN + Forwarded panel
occupies the left half.
- `src/bin/fipstop/ui/listening.rs` renders the right half.
- `main.rs` fetches the new query each tick when the Node tab is
active. Errors are non-fatal: an old daemon without the query
leaves the payload at None and the panel renders "loading...".
`Cargo.toml` gains `procfs = "0.18"` on the Linux target. IPv4
listeners are not enumerated — fips0 is IPv6-only.
Folded in: revert the default-socket lookup from writability-probe
back to existence-based selection. The previous tempfile-probe on
`/run/fips` silently steered fipstop / fipsctl onto an XDG path
the daemon never bound for any user in the `fips` group whose
shell session had not yet picked up the supplementary group (no
re-login after `usermod -aG`). `XDG_RUNTIME_DIR` is set on every
modern systemd-managed user session, so this hit the common case.
The kernel checks actual group membership at `connect(2)`, so a
user who genuinely cannot connect now gets a clear `EACCES`
rather than a silent path mismatch. Drops the now-unused
`is_writable_dir` helper. `XDG_RUNTIME_DIR` existence validation
is preserved.

# Control Socket Protocol
|
|
|
|
The FIPS daemon and `fips-gateway` each expose a local control socket
|
|
that accepts line-delimited JSON requests and returns line-delimited
|
|
JSON responses. `fipsctl` and `fipstop` are clients of this protocol;
|
|
operators can also drive it directly with any tool that can speak
|
|
length-bounded JSON over a stream socket.
|
|
|
|
## Connection
|
|
|
|
### Linux / macOS
|
|
|
|
A Unix domain socket. The default path is resolved in this order:
|
|
|
|
1. `/run/fips/control.sock` (or `/run/fips/gateway.sock` for the
|
|
gateway), if `/run/fips` exists. This is what the `fips.service`
|
|
systemd unit creates.
|
|
2. `$XDG_RUNTIME_DIR/fips/control.sock` otherwise.
|
|
3. `/tmp/fips-control.sock` if neither of the above is available.
|
|
|
|
The daemon `chown`s the socket file and its parent directory to the
|
|
`fips` group at bind time and sets mode `0770`. Members of the `fips`
|
|
group can therefore connect without root. Add a user with
|
|
`sudo usermod -aG fips $USER` (re-login required).
|
|
|
|
The path can be overridden at the daemon side via
|
|
`node.control.socket_path` in the YAML config, and at the client side
|
|
via `fipsctl -s PATH` or `fipstop -s PATH`.
|
|
|
|
### Windows
|
|
|
|
A TCP listener bound to `127.0.0.1`. The daemon's port is `21210` by
|
|
default; the gateway's is `21211`. Only loopback connections are
|
|
accepted. Override via `node.control.socket_path` (which takes a port
|
|
number string on Windows).
|
|
|
|
Windows TCP does not provide filesystem-level ACLs — any local user
|
|
can connect. See the security note in
|
|
[configuration.md](configuration.md#control-socket-nodecontrol).

## Request Format
|
|
|
|
One JSON object per line, terminated by `\n`. Maximum request size is
|
|
4096 bytes; longer requests are dropped with `request too large`.
|
|
|
|
```json
|
|
{"command": "<name>", "params": {<object>}}
|
|
```
|
|
|
|
| Field | Type | Required | Description |
|
|
| ----- | ---- | -------- | ----------- |
|
|
| `command` | string | yes | Command name. See [Daemon command catalog](#daemon-command-catalog) and [Gateway command catalog](#gateway-command-catalog). |
|
|
| `params` | object | only for commands that take parameters | Parameter object. Unknown fields are ignored; missing required fields produce an error response. |
|
|
|
|
Unknown top-level fields in the request are silently ignored.
|
|
|
|
## Response Format
|
|
|
|
One JSON object per line.
|
|
|
|
```json
|
|
{"status": "ok", "data": {<object>}}
|
|
{"status": "error", "message": "<reason>"}
|
|
```
|
|
|
|
| Field | Type | When present |
|
|
| ----- | ---- | ------------ |
|
|
| `status` | string | always; one of `"ok"` or `"error"`. |
|
|
| `data` | object | on `ok` responses. |
|
|
| `message` | string | on `error` responses. |
|
|
|
|
### I/O timeouts
|
|
|
|
The daemon enforces a 5-second timeout for both the request read and
|
|
the response write. If the connection idles longer than that, the
|
|
daemon closes it with no response.
|
|
|
|
### Common error messages
|
|
|
|
| Message | Cause |
|
|
| ------- | ----- |
|
|
| `empty request` | Connection closed before a newline was received. |
|
|
| `invalid request: <serde error>` | Malformed JSON or missing `command`. |
|
|
| `request too large` | Request exceeded 4096 bytes. |
|
|
| `read timeout` / `read error: ...` | Slow client or transport failure. |
|
|
| `unknown command: <name>` | Command not registered with this daemon. |
|
|
| `missing params for <name>` | Command requires `params` but none were provided. |
|
|
| `missing '<field>' parameter` | Required parameter missing. |
|
|
| `query timeout` | Internal handler did not respond within 5 seconds. |
|
|
| `node shutting down` | Daemon is exiting. |
|
|
| `gateway not yet initialized` | (Gateway socket only) snapshot has not been published yet. |

## Daemon Command Catalog
|
|
|
|
Read-only queries are dispatched in `src/control/queries.rs`;
|
|
mutating commands are dispatched in `src/control/commands.rs`. The
|
|
table below lists every command currently registered.
|
|
|
|
### Read-only queries
|
|
|
|
| Command | Params | `data` shape (top-level keys) |
|
|
| ------- | ------ | ----------------------------- |
|
|
| `show_status` | — | `version`, `npub`, `node_addr`, `ipv6_addr`, `state`, `is_leaf_only`, `peer_count`, `session_count`, `link_count`, `transport_count`, `connection_count`, `tun_state`, `tun_name`, `effective_ipv6_mtu`, `control_socket`, `pid`, `exe_path`, `uptime_secs`, `estimated_mesh_size`, `forwarding`, `sparklines`. |
|
|
| `show_acl` | — | `allow_file`, `deny_file`, `enforcement_active`, `effective_mode`, `default_decision`, `allow_all`, `deny_all`, `allow_file_entries`, `deny_file_entries`, `allow_entries`, `deny_entries`. |
|
|
| `show_peers` | — | `peers[]` — per-peer object: `node_addr`, `npub`, `display_name`, `ipv6_addr`, `connectivity`, `link_id`, `direction`, `transport_addr`, `transport_type`, `is_parent`, `is_child`, `tree_depth`, `stats`, `noise`, `current_k_bit`, `mmp`, plus optional `nostr_traversal`, `rekey_in_progress`, `rekey_draining`. |
|
|
| `show_links` | — | `links[]` — `link_id`, `transport_id`, `remote_addr`, `direction`, `state`, `created_at_ms`, `stats`. |
|
|
| `show_tree` | — | `my_node_addr`, `root`, `is_root`, `depth`, `my_coords[]`, `parent`, `parent_display_name`, `declaration_sequence`, `declaration_signed`, `peer_tree_count`, `peers[]`, `stats`. |
|
|
| `show_sessions` | — | `sessions[]` — `remote_addr`, `npub`, `display_name`, `state` (`established`, `initiating`, `awaiting_msg3`, `unknown`), `is_initiator`, `last_activity_ms`, `stats`, optional `mmp`, `current_k_bit`, `is_draining`. |
|
|
| `show_bloom` | — | `own_node_addr`, `is_leaf_only`, `sequence`, `leaf_dependent_count`, `leaf_dependents[]`, `peer_filters[]`, `stats`. |
|
|
| `show_mmp` | — | `peers[]` (link-layer per peer), `sessions[]` (session-layer per session). Each entry includes loss/RTT/ETX/goodput, smoothed values, trends. |
|
|
| `show_cache` | — | `count`, `max_entries`, `fill_ratio`, `default_ttl_ms`, `expired`, `avg_age_ms`, `entries[]` — per-destination coords, depth, age, last-used, optional `path_mtu`. |
|
|
| `show_connections` | — | `connections[]` — pending handshakes: `link_id`, `direction`, `handshake_state`, `started_at_ms`, `idle_ms`, `resend_count`, optional `expected_peer`. |
|
|
| `show_transports` | — | `transports[]` — `transport_id`, `type`, `state`, `mtu`, `name`, `local_addr`, optional `tor_mode`, `onion_address`, `tor_monitoring`, `stats`. |
|
|
| `show_routing` | — | `coord_cache_entries`, `identity_cache_entries`, `pending_lookups[]`, `pending_tun_destinations`, `pending_tun_packets`, `recent_requests`, `retries[]`, `forwarding`, `discovery`, `error_signals`, `congestion`. |
|
|
| `show_identity_cache` | — | `entries[]`, `count`, `max_entries`. Each entry: `node_addr`, `npub`, `display_name`, `ipv6_addr`, `last_seen_ms`, `age_ms`. |
|
|
| `show_listening_sockets` | — | `fips0_addr`, `firewall_active` (bool — `inet fips` table loaded), `sockets[]`. Each entry: `proto` (`tcp` / `udp`), `local_addr` (`::` or the node's fd00::/8 address), `port`, `pid` (nullable), `process` (nullable), `wildcard_bind` (bool — `local_addr == ::`), `filter` (`accept` / `drop` / `unknown` / `no_firewall`). Linux-only; returns an empty `sockets[]` on other platforms. |
|
|
| `show_stats_list` | — | `metrics[]` (each with `name`, `unit`, `scope`), `fast_ring_seconds`, `slow_ring_minutes`, `peer_retention_seconds`. |
|
|
| `show_stats_history` | `metric` (req), `peer` (req for per-peer metrics), `window` (`<N>s` / `<N>m` / `<N>h`, default `10m`), `granularity` (`1s` / `1m`, default `1s`) | A single `Series`: `metric`, `unit`, `granularity_seconds`, `values[]`. |
|
|
| `show_stats_all_history` | `peer` (optional npub), `window`, `granularity` | `granularity_seconds`, `window_seconds`, `peer`, `series[]` (one per metric). |
|
|
| `show_stats_peers` | — | `peers[]`, `count`. Each entry: `npub`, `node_addr`, `display_name`, `is_active`, `first_seen_secs_ago`, `last_contact_secs_ago`. |
|
|
| `show_stats_history_all_peers` | `metric` (req per-peer name), `window`, `granularity` | `metric`, `unit`, `granularity_seconds`, `window_seconds`, `peers[]` (each with `node_addr`, `display_name`, `is_active`, `values[]`). |
|
|
|
|
The schema of each query response is pinned by snapshot tests in
|
|
`src/control/snapshots/`; intentional schema changes regenerate those
|
|
fixtures.
|
|
|
|
### Mutating commands
|
|
|
|
| Command | Required params | Behaviour |
|
|
| ------- | --------------- | --------- |
|
|
| `connect` | `npub` (bech32), `address` (transport endpoint), `transport` (`udp`, `tcp`, `tor`, `ethernet`) | Asks the node to dial the peer over the named transport. Returns the API result on success or an error string on failure. |
|
|
| `disconnect` | `npub` (bech32) | Asks the node to drop the link to the named peer. |
|
|
|
|
Both commands run on the daemon's main task and may block briefly
|
|
while the node mutates its state.
|
|
|
|
## Gateway Command Catalog
|
|
|
|
`fips-gateway` exposes a separate control socket with its own command
|
|
set. Dispatch lives in `src/gateway/control.rs`.
|
|
|
|
| Command | Params | `data` shape |
|
|
| ------- | ------ | ------------ |
|
|
| `show_gateway` | — | `pool_total`, `pool_allocated`, `pool_active`, `pool_draining`, `pool_free`, `nat_mappings`, `dns_listen`, `uptime_secs`, `pool_cidr`, `lan_interface`, `dns_upstream`, `dns_ttl`, `pool_grace_period`. |
|
|
| `show_mappings` | — | `mappings[]` — `virtual_ip`, `mesh_addr`, `node_addr`, `dns_name`, `state` (`Allocated`, `Active`, `Draining`), `sessions`, `age_secs`, `last_ref_secs`. |
|
|
|
|
Until the first snapshot has been published (very early in startup),
|
|
both commands return `gateway not yet initialized`.

## Driving the Socket Directly
|
|
|
|
```sh
|
|
# Linux / macOS
|
|
echo '{"command":"show_status"}' | sudo nc -U /run/fips/control.sock
|
|
|
|
# Windows (PowerShell with a TCP-capable tool of your choice)
|
|
```
|
|
|
|
The newline at the end of the request is required: the daemon reads
|
|
one line per connection. The connection is closed after the single
|
|
response is written.
